About California Taxes on $135,000
California has one of the highest state tax rates, with a top marginal rate of 13.3%.
On a $135,000 salary, California state income tax comes to $8,614 (6.4% effective state rate). Combined with federal tax ($21,134) and FICA ($10,328), your total tax bill is $40,075 — leaving you $94,925 after tax.
